Contact Information
Thuraiyur Road, Perambalur, Tamil Nadu, 621 212, India
Detailed Information
The world is constantly in need of physicians and hospitals. Man discovers, finds and invents new ideas and technologies day by day that make his life comfortable. Simultaneously and unknowingly, he paves the way for new conditions and aliments. Hence the need for physicians and cures exists forever.